Professor Matsos wants to determine if rewards will increase recycling efforts on campus. The dependent variable in this example
MatroZZZ [7]

The dependent variable in this example is the amount of recycling done on campus.

<h3>What is a dependent variable?</h3>
  • The dependent variable is the variable that is being estimated or tried in an experiment.
  • For instance, in a review seeing how coaching influences test scores, the reliant variable would be the members' grades, since that is the thing being estimated.
  • The dependent variable is a measurement of a particular component of a participant's behavior in many psychology experiments and studies.
  • Test performance would be the dependent variable in an experiment investigating the impact of sleep on performance.
  • Stability is frequently indicative of a more reliable dependent variable.
  • The effects on the dependent variable should almost match those from the original experiment if the same experiment is repeated with the same subjects, surroundings, and experimental manipulations.

Hence, the amount of recycling done on campus is the dependent variable in this illustration.
